We often think of the army as an institution whose members are
required to blindly obey all orders they receive. However, this
perception is inaccurate. Disobedience is a fundamental
professional obligation of members of the military and overrides
the obligation to follow commands. But what is the extent of this
obligation? Are soldiers obligated to participate in what they
consider to be an illegal war, or should they be allowed to enjoy a
right to selective conscientious objection? Should soldiers obey a
legal order that, if followed, would facilitate the perpetration of
war crimes by a third party? How should soldiers act if they are
ordered to follow a lawful order that could result in immoral
consequences? Should soldiers be allowed to refuse to obey what can
be labeled as suicidal orders? Based upon the nature of soldiers'
professional obligations, this book tries to offer answers to these
important questions. The author turns to a number of different
case-studies, including conscientious objections, duty to protect
in genocidal situations such as Rwanda and Srebrenica, suicidal
orders in wars, as well as retribution and leniency towards war
criminals, as a way of assessing the different legal and ethical
implications of disobedience in the military.
